Analysis
The most recent figure for on-farm energy use — emissions in Denmark is 0.5208 kt, measured in 2023.
The figure is down 8.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, on-farm energy use — emissions in Denmark peaked at 0.7071 kt in 1992 and was at its lowest, 0.4768 kt, in 2020.
That places Denmark 30th out of 169 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 34 years of available data.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
